The cheapest way to get from Stockport to Sutton Coldfield is to drive which costs £16 - £25 and takes 1h 52m.
The fastest way to get from Stockport to Sutton Coldfield is to train via Lichfield Trent Valley High Level which takes 1h 32m and costs £24 - £45.
No, there is no direct bus from Stockport to Sutton Coldfield. However, there are services departing from Garrick Theatre and arriving at Good Hope Hospital via Manchester Airport The Station and Tesco Express.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 3h 26m.
No, there is no direct train from Stockport to Sutton Coldfield. However, there are services departing from Stockport and arriving at Sutton Coldfield via Lichfield Trent Valley High Level.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 1h 32m.
The distance between Stockport and Sutton Coldfield is 71 miles. The road distance is 70.1 miles.
The best way to get from Stockport to Sutton Coldfield without a car is to train via Lichfield Trent Valley High Level which takes 1h 32m and costs £24 - £45.
It takes approximately 1h 32m to get from Stockport to Sutton Coldfield, including transfers.
